Interactions between people from different categories, such as gender, age, or other demographic factors, can vary widely based on cultural norms, social context, individual beliefs, and societal attitudes. These interactions can lead to various outcomes:
1. **Stereotyping and Bias:** People might hold preconceived notions or stereotypes about individuals from different categories. This can lead to biases and discrimination based on characteristics such as gender, age, race, or socioeconomic status.
2. **Inclusion and Exclusion:** In social settings, people may gravitate towards those who are similar to them and exclude those perceived as different. This can result in both positive and negative social experiences.
3. **Empathy and Understanding:** Interactions between people from different categories can foster empathy and understanding, as individuals learn about each other's experiences, challenges, and perspectives. This can promote tolerance and reduce prejudices.
4. **Conflict and Misunderstanding:** Differences in opinions, values, and cultural backgrounds can lead to misunderstandings and conflicts. These conflicts can arise from differences in communication styles, beliefs, and expectations.
5. **Collaboration and Innovation:** Interactions across categories can lead to the exchange of diverse ideas and perspectives. This can promote creativity and innovation by combining different viewpoints and approaches.
6. **Power Dynamics:** Interactions between individuals from different categories can also involve power dynamics. For example, interactions between different age groups or hierarchical positions may involve the assertion of authority or influence.
7. **Social Change:** Positive interactions between individuals from different categories can contribute to social change by challenging stereotypes and promoting more inclusive attitudes and policies.
In essence, interactions between people of different categories can result in a wide range of social dynamics, from positive and inclusive relationships to conflicts and biases. The outcome depends on factors such as individuals' openness, willingness to engage with diverse perspectives, and the broader societal context.
